Courses | Eligibility |
---|---|
B.Sc. | Candidate must have passed in 10+2 or qualifying examination with Physics, Chemistry and Biology as optional subjects and English as one of the languages of study and obtained an aggregate minimum of mentioned marks in Physics, Chemistry and Biology subjects in the qualifying examination from a recognized board. (35% of marks in qualifying examination is required in case of Category€“I and OBC (2A, 2B, 3A and 3B) Category candidates). Result awaited candidates can also apply. NOTE: The SC / ST/Category-I / 2A, 2B, 3A and 3B and other eligibility criteria is applicable to Karnataka candidates who are eligible to claim eligibility for Government seats under clauses (a), (b), (f), (h), (j), (k) (l) and (o) and the same is not applicable to eligibility clauses (c), (d), (e), (g), (i), (m) and (n) to claim Government Seats and Government quota seats as per proviso of rule 9 (2) of CET-2006 Admission Rules. |
MS | Candidate must have completed MBBS degree or provisional MBBS pass certificate which is recognized as per the provisions of the NMC Act, 2019 and the repealed Indian Medical Council Act 1956. Candidate should also possess a permanent or provisional registration certificate of MBBS qualification issued by the NMC/ the erstwhile Medical Council of India or State Medical Council. Candidate must have completed one year of internship or are likely to complete the internship on or before 31st March 2023. |

Sanjay Gandhi Institute of Trauma and Orthopaedic offers Specializations in fields of study such as;
Courses | Total Seats | Specializations |
---|---|---|
B.Sc. | 10-30 | Anaesthesia Technology, Medical Laboratory Technology |
MS | 10 | Orthopaedics |
BMLT | - | Medical Laboratory Technology |
